Baden-Württemberg precipitation in November

Baden-Württemberg is a region in Germany. In November precipitation ranges from moderate in Mannheim with 67 mm of rainfall to high in Todtmoos with 121 mm of rainfall.

  • What is the wettest city in November in Baden-Württemberg?
  • Based on our records, Todtmoos is the location with the highest average precipitation, receiving about 121 mm.

  • What is the driest city in November in Baden-Württemberg?
  • The driest place is Mannheim with an average precipitation of 67 mm according to our data.
